OT: Tres Realizadoras Portuguesas

Three promising female directors, three short films acclaimed at festivals like Cannes, Venice and Rotterdam, united in one package: PARTY DAY by Sofia Bost, DOGS BARKING AT BIRDS by Leonor Teles and RUBY by Mariana Gaivão represent exciting young cinema from Portugal.

Party Day

Director: Sofia Bost,
World Premiere: Cannes "La Semaine Internationale de la Critique" 2019.

Portugal
2019, 17'
16mm, DCP
Portuguese with German subtitles

Mena lives alone with her daughter Clara. Today is Clara's seventh birthday. Despite her limited financial means, she manages to organize a birthday party. However, her mother's phone call throws her off track emotionally. The film shows the difficulties of being a mother, a daughter, a friend and still leading a self-determined life.

Dogs Barking at Birds

Director: Leonor Teles
World Premiere: Venice Biennale Short Film, Nominated for the 2019 European Short Film Awards.

Portugal
2019, 20'
16mm, DCP
Portuguese with German subtitles

School is out and there is a buzz in the air. In Porto, tourists populate the streets and cafes. Vicente rides his bike through the city and observes the changes that take place day by day. The city is no longer the same, the world is changing and so is he. Surrounded by his family and friends, Vicente eagerly awaits the first days of summer and the beginning of a new life.

Ruby

Director: Mariana Gaivão

Portugal
2019, 25'
DCP
Portuguese with German subtitles

A hot summer day in a Portuguese village, ending with a farewell party for her best friend who is returning to England, marks the end of her youth for Ruby. Ruby is a diamond in the rough, full of energy, which is reflected in the pleasantly relaxed atmosphere of the film and the music of Sonic Youth.
